Understanding Coastal Challenges
Living by the coast comes with its own set of rugged realities. The proximity to water, while idyllic, subjects buildings to a barrage of environmental stressors. Saltwater corrosion, high winds, moisture intrusion, and temperature fluctuations can accelerate the wear and tear on traditional roofing materials. In this context, understanding the unique challenges presented by coastal environments is crucial for both homeowners and builders alike. It’s here that the properties of copper come into play, proving itself as an unparalleled choice for resilience.
The saline air in coastal regions can be particularly corrosive to metals, leading many builders to worry about the longevity of their roofing systems. Most commonly used materials, such as asphalt and fiberglass, simply don’t hold up well under these conditions. They can warp, crack, or even completely fail over time. However, copper flashing offers a significant advantage due to its natural resistance to corrosion and ability to develop a protective patina, which further enhances its durability. By utilizing copper, builders can create structures that not only withstand the elements but also require less frequent maintenance and repairs, translating into long-term cost savings.
Additionally, high winds can disrupt traditional roofing installations, leading to issues such as shingle displacement and leaks. Copper flashing integrates seamlessly with various roofing systems, providing additional layers of protection and ensuring that the transition between different materials is seamlessly executed. This not only bolsters the structural integrity of the roof but also minimizes the risk of water infiltration that can lead to expensive repairs. Installation Insights for Contractors
Proper installation of copper flashing is integral to ensuring a long and successful service life. Whether you’re a seasoned roofer or a custom home builder, understanding the nuances of copper flashing installation is essential. First and foremost, it’s vital to prepare the working area by ensuring that the substrate is clean, dry, and free from debris. This fundamental step will help in achieving a secure and effective bonding surface for the flashing and roofing materials.
Contractors should also take note of the various types of copper flashing available, understanding the specific application for each type. For instance, step flashing is designed for the junction between angled roofing and vertical surfaces such as walls, while chimney flashing is specifically tailored for chimney installations. Familiarizing oneself with these distinctions is crucial in maximizing the effectiveness and longevity of the flashing, preventing future water intrusion or structural damage.
Finally, one of the most common pitfalls contractors face is improper overlapping of the flashing seams. Ensuring that the seams are correctly oriented to shed water is imperative. A recommended practice is to adhere to a 2-inch overlap, as well as securely fastening the flashing with high-quality, corrosion-resistant screws to prevent movement over time. Taking these steps has been shown to not only enhance the performance of flashing but also bolster the overall integrity of the roofing system—serving as a vital line of defense against the elements.
